On 10 Nov 2004 at 22:24, Terry Cost wrote: > I've recently acquired a complete but wrecked '73 square as a parts car > for my '70 square. The fuel injection looks complete and un-hacked. My > question: which is the better set-up, '70 or '73 fuel injection? I know that > the system in my '70 works, and I'm assuming that the '73 works (it was in > an accident, which implies movement ;). My favorite year for FI is the '71 (D brain) which actually started in about Jan of '70. Second favorite would be the earlier '70 (C brain) version, which is very similar. The '72 is at the bottom of the list, and I put the '73 just one step above that. If the front axle beam is good on the '73, then that is very desirable due to the larger brakes.
